I sometimes feel it to be an absolute miracle that the entire black population of the United States of America has not long ago succumbed to raging paranoia.  People finally say to you, in an attempt to dismiss the social reality, "But you're so bitter!"  Well, I may or may not be bitter, but if I were, I would have good reasons for it: chief among them that American blindness, or cowardice, which allows us to pretend that life presents no reasons for being bitter.

-- James Baldwin, I Am Not Your Negro, p. 98
